fre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

宿舍管理系統(tǒng)代碼實現(xiàn)(已改無錯字)

2022-08-21 18:39:54 本頁面
  

【正文】 ror GoTo errPathName = amp。 \dbasize = FileLen(PathName)err:Exit Sub數(shù)據備份部分在本程序中用到了一個模塊,在模塊中有一個方法,dobackup。點擊備份按鈕后開始備份,代碼如下:If txtDestination ThenDoBackup PathName, txtDestinationMsgBox 備份成功!, , 提示ElseIf txtDestination = ThenMsgBox You must specify a distination for the backup, vbCritical其中DoBackup為模塊中已定義的方法,在這里進行調用。Dobackup實現(xiàn)方法代碼如下所示:Dim lFileOp As LongDim lresult As LongDim lFlags As LongDim SHFileOp As SHFILEOPSTRUCTDim strSourceDir As StringDim strDestinationDir As String = vbHourglassBackupFolderName = strDestinationPathMkDir BackupFolderName amp。 \Backup amp。 Format(Date, )lFileOp = FO_COPYlFlags = lFlags And Not FOF_SILENTlFlags = lFlags Or FOF_NOCONFIRMATIONlFlags = lFlags Or FOF_NOCONFIRMMKDIRlFlags = lFlags Or FOF_FILESONLYWith SHFileOp .wFunc = lFileOp .pFrom = strSourcePath amp。 vbNullChar .pTo = strDestinationPath amp。 \Backup amp。 Format(Date, ) amp。 vbNullChar .fFlags = lFlagsEnd Withlresult = SHFileOperation(SHFileOp) = vbDefault = Backup Complete在備份分前先要選擇一個備份路徑,點擊…那個按鈕開始進行選擇,實現(xiàn)方法如下:Dim strTemp As StringstrTemp = fBrowseForFolder(, Select backup path)If strTemp Then txtDestination = strTempEnd If數(shù)據恢復界面同上,它的功能主要是在當前數(shù)據庫遭到破壞后,可以利用它來進行數(shù)據恢復,在數(shù)據恢復前要選擇所要恢復的數(shù)據庫路徑,如下:Dim strTemp As StringstrTemp = fBrowseForFolder(, Restore From)If strTemp Then txtSource = strTemp dbasize2 = FileLen(txtSource amp。 \) lblSelectedDba = Selected Backup Database is : amp。 Format((dbasize2 / 1024) / 1024, standard) amp。 MB. = TrueEnd IfErro: Select Case Case 53 39。File Not Found lblSelectedDba = No Backup at this location = False End Select它主要是查看數(shù)據庫是否存在,如果所恢復的數(shù)據不存在,則會提示錯誤。數(shù)據恢復也用到了一個方法,在模塊中也已經定義了該方法DoRestore。數(shù)據恢復代碼如下:If MsgBox(Restoring database from location amp。 txtSource amp。 will replace existing database you want to Contunue, vbYesNo) = vbYes ThenDoRestore , If NoDba = True Then MsgBox Database Restored Click Ok to Exit Program Unload frmRestoreDbaEnd IfElse = Database Restore CanceledEnd If其中DoRestore實現(xiàn)的功能源碼如下所示:DEFSOURCE = PROVIDER=。Persist Security Info=False。Data Source=DBName = \。Jet OLEDB:Database Password=matrixse。Set Db = New DEFSOURCE amp。 amp。 DBNameDim lFileOp As LongDim lresult As LongDim lFlags As LongDim SHFileOp As SHFILEOPSTRUCTDim strSourceDir As StringDim strDestinationDir As String = vbHourglassBackupFolderName = strDestinationPathlFileOp = FO_COPYlFlags = lFlags And Not FOF_SILENTlFlags = lFlags Or FOF_NOCONFIRMATIONlFlags = lFlags Or FOF_NOCONFIRMMKDIRlFlags = lFlags Or FOF_FILESONLYWith SHFileOp .wFunc = lFileOp .pFrom = strSourcePath amp。 \ amp。 vbNullChar .pTo = strDestinationPath amp。 vbNullChar .fFlags = lFlagsEnd Withlresult = SHFileOperation(SHFileOp)Set Db = New DEFSOURCE amp。 amp。 DBName = vbDefault = Restore Complete說明:本程序中此部分內容參考了網上的同類型代碼,對其進行修改后得到此成型作品,從功能上來講,它已經實現(xiàn)了它所要完成的工作,經過測試已經沒有問題,但是實現(xiàn)的源代碼,也只有部分掌握。這實屬本人精力與能力有限所置。四、 學生宿舍管理 學生請假 學生請假與違規(guī)在一個公寓管理中是最常見的問題了,所以在此軟件中加上了這兩項功能。用它們可以隨時記錄請假記錄。①學生請假記錄圖片顯示② 界面制作與實現(xiàn) 此界面主要是對學生請假記錄做一個添加。利用它可以把學生的基本的請假資料保存起來。其中的日期是系統(tǒng)當前的日期,它是不可以進行更改的,然后在其它文本框中輸入其它詳細資料即可以。這里的添加操作用的是Adodc控件,所有的文本框在初始的時候沒有同Adodc綁定,而是在代碼中與數(shù)據庫中表的字段進行的綁定,然后進行添加操作。這樣做在使用的時候有很大的方便之處。第一是窗體在初始化時不會顯示任何記錄,不用設置文本框為空等一系列的操作。第二是當進行記錄輸入時,發(fā)現(xiàn)問題不用輸入時,不按添加按鈕記錄就不會進行添加。注意的是,在添加前要確定所有的文本框都要進行詳細填寫,否則會提示輸入詳細信息。添加主要代碼如下:If = Or = Or = Or = Or = Or = Or = Or = Or = Then MsgBox 請輸入詳細信息!, , 系統(tǒng)提示ElseWith Adodc1..(0).Value = .(1).Value = .(2).Value = .(3)
點擊復制文檔內容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1